-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
互联网应用框架安全防护措施
互联网应用框架安全防护措施
一、互联网应用框架安全防护措施概述
互联网应用框架作为现代网络应用的核心基础架构,其安全性直接关系到用户数据的保密性、完整性和可用性。随着互联网的飞速发展,网络攻击手段日益复杂多样,针对互联网应用框架的安全威胁也不断增加。因此,研究并实施有效的安全防护措施,对于保障互联网应用的正常运行和用户信息安全至关重要。
互联网应用框架的安全防护需要从多个层面进行综合考虑,包括网络层面、应用层面、数据层面以及管理层面等。网络层面的安全防护主要关注如何防止外部攻击者通过网络漏洞入侵系统,例如通过防火墙、入侵检测系统等技术手段来监控和过滤网络流量,阻止恶意攻击的进入。应用层面的安全防护则侧重于对应用代码本身的安全性进行审查和加固,防止诸如SQL注入、跨站脚本攻击(XSS)等常见的应用层攻击。数据层面的安全防护则聚焦于保护用户数据的隐私和完整性,通过加密、访问控制等技术确保数据在存储和传输过程中的安全。管理层面的安全防护则涉及到安全策略的制定、人员权限的管理以及安全事件的应急响应等方面,通过建立健全的安全管理制度来保障整个应用框架的安全运行。
二、互联网应用框架安全防护措施的实施
网络层面的安全防护
网络层面的安全防护是互联网应用框架安全防护的第一道防线。防火墙是网络层面安全防护的关键设备之一,它可以根据预设的安全规则对进出网络的流量进行过滤,阻止未经授权的访问和恶意流量的进入。例如,通过设置防火墙规则,可以限制外部对内部服务器的访问,只允许特定的端口和服务对外提供,从而有效减少网络攻击的入口点。
除了防火墙,入侵检测系统(IDS)和入侵防御系统(IPS)也是网络层面不可或缺的安全防护工具。IDS主要用于检测网络中的异常行为和攻击迹象,通过对网络流量的实时监控和分析,及时发现潜在的安全威胁并发出警报。IPS则在此基础上进一步具备了主动防御的能力,它不仅可以检测到攻击行为,还可以在攻击发生时自动采取措施阻止攻击的继续进行,例如通过阻断攻击者的网络连接等方式来保护系统免受攻击。
此外,网络隔离技术也是加强网络层面安全防护的有效手段。通过将不同的网络区域进行隔离,例如将内部网络与外部网络、开发环境与生产环境等进行物理或逻辑上的隔离,可以有效防止攻击者在突破一层网络后轻易地扩散到其他网络区域,从而降低安全事件的影响范围。
应用层面的安全防护
应用层面的安全防护是互联网应用框架安全防护的重点环节。应用代码的安全性是应用层面安全防护的核心,因此对应用代码进行严格的安全审查和测试是必不可少的。代码审计可以通过人工或自动化工具对应用代码进行逐行检查,查找可能存在的安全漏洞,例如SQL注入漏洞、XSS漏洞、跨站请求伪造(CSRF)漏洞等。通过修复这些漏洞,可以有效防止攻击者利用应用代码的缺陷进行攻击。
除了代码审计,应用安全加固也是应用层面安全防护的重要措施。这包括对应用服务器进行安全配置,例如关闭不必要的服务和端口,限制应用的权限,确保应用运行在最低权限的环境中,从而减少应用被攻击的风险。同时,对应用进行安全更新和补丁管理也至关重要,及时修复已知的安全漏洞可以有效防止攻击者利用这些漏洞进行攻击。
此外,应用层面的安全防护还需要关注第三方库和组件的安全性。许多现代互联网应用依赖大量的第三方库和组件来实现各种功能,然而这些第三方库和组件可能存在未知的安全漏洞。因此,对第三方库和组件进行安全评估和管理,及时更新到安全版本,是确保应用层面安全的重要环节。
数据层面的安全防护
数据层面的安全防护是互联网应用框架安全防护的重要组成部分。用户数据的隐私和完整性是数据层面安全防护的核心目标。数据加密是保护数据隐私的重要技术手段,通过对敏感数据进行加密处理,即使数据在存储或传输过程中被攻击者窃取,攻击者也无法直接获取数据的内容。数据加密可以分为存储加密和传输加密,存储加密主要用于保护存储在数据库或文件系统中的数据,传输加密则主要用于保护数据在网络传输过程中的安全。
访问控制是数据层面安全防护的另一项关键技术。通过建立严格的访问控制策略,可以限制对敏感数据的访问权限,确保只有授权的用户和应用才能访问数据。访问控制策略可以根据用户的身份、角色、权限等进行灵活配置,例如通过角色基于访问控制(RBAC)模型,可以为不同角色的用户分配不同的访问权限,从而实现细粒度的访问控制。
此外,数据备份和恢复也是数据层面安全防护的重要环节。通过定期对数据进行备份,可以在数据丢失或损坏的情况下快速恢复数据,确保应用的正常运行和数据的可用性。同时,对数据备份进行安全管理,防止备份数据被攻击者窃取或篡改,也是数据层面安全防护的重要内容。
管理层面的安全防护
管理层面的安全防护是互联网应用框架安全防护的重要保障。建立健全的安全管理制度是管理层面安
原创力文档


文档评论(0)